메뉴 건너뛰기




Volumn 30, Issue 12, 2004, Pages 970-992

Object analysis patterns for embedded systems

Author keywords

Conceptual modeling; Embedded systems; Formal specification; Model checking; Object analysis; Object oriented modeling; Patterns; Requirements

Indexed keywords

COMPUTATIONAL COMPLEXITY; COMPUTER PROGRAMMING LANGUAGES; EMBEDDED SYSTEMS; MATHEMATICAL MODELS; OBJECT ORIENTED PROGRAMMING; REQUIREMENTS ENGINEERING; SYSTEMS ANALYSIS; USER INTERFACES;

EID: 23844436404     PISSN: 00985589     EISSN: None     Source Type: Journal    
DOI: 10.1109/TSE.2004.102     Document Type: Article
Times cited : (41)

References (53)
  • 1
    • 33645269926 scopus 로고    scopus 로고
    • Systems Modeling Language
    • Systems Modeling Language, http://www.sysml.org, 2004.
    • (2004)
  • 7
    • 33645255595 scopus 로고    scopus 로고
    • "Enabling Integrative Analyses and Refinement of Object-Oriented Models with Special Emphasis on High-Assurance Embedded Systems"
    • PhD thesis, Michigan State Univ., East Lansing
    • L.A. Campbell, "Enabling Integrative Analyses and Refinement of Object-Oriented Models with Special Emphasis on High-Assurance Embedded Systems," PhD thesis, Michigan State Univ., East Lansing, 2004.
    • (2004)
    • Campbell, L.A.1
  • 9
    • 33645252410 scopus 로고    scopus 로고
    • "Enabling Validation of UML Formalizations"
    • Technical Report MSU-CSE-03-20, Dept. of Computer Science, Michigan State Univ., East Lansing, July
    • B.H.C. Cheng, R.E.K. Stirewalt, M. Deng, and L. Campbell, "Enabling Validation of UML Formalizations," Technical Report MSU-CSE-03-20, Dept. of Computer Science, Michigan State Univ., East Lansing, July 2003.
    • (2003)
    • Cheng, B.H.C.1    Stirewalt, R.E.K.2    Deng, M.3    Campbell, L.4
  • 13
    • 33645267571 scopus 로고    scopus 로고
    • "Designing Real-Time Systems With UML-Part I"
    • B.P. Douglass, "Designing Real-Time Systems With UML-Part I," http://www.embedded.com/98/9803fe2.htm, 1998.
    • (1998)
    • Douglass, B.P.1
  • 17
    • 33645266568 scopus 로고    scopus 로고
    • "Society of Automotive Engineers (SAE) Embedded Software Activities Update"
    • B. Emaus and B. Gruszczynski, "Society of Automotive Engineers (SAE) Embedded Software Activities Update," 2003, http://www.gl-spin.org/ Meetings/Meeting_Archive/SAE_Embedded_software_activities_update31303.pdf.
    • (2003)
    • Emaus, B.1    Gruszczynski, B.2
  • 18
    • 33645269029 scopus 로고    scopus 로고
    • EventHelix.com, Realtime mantra
    • EventHelix.com, Realtime mantra, 2004, http://www.eventhelix.com/ RealtimeMantra.
    • (2004)
  • 19
    • 33645251419 scopus 로고    scopus 로고
    • "Good Analysis as the Basis for Good Design and Implementation"
    • Technical Report TR-CSE-97-45, Florida Atlantic Univ., Sept.
    • E. Fernandez, "Good Analysis as the Basis for Good Design and Implementation," Technical Report TR-CSE-97-45, Florida Atlantic Univ., Sept. 1997.
    • (1997)
    • Fernandez, E.1
  • 23
    • 23844471166 scopus 로고    scopus 로고
    • "Software Engineering with Analysis Patterns"
    • A. Geyer-Schulz and M. Hahsler, "Software Engineering with Analysis Patterns," 2001, http://wwwai.wu-wien.ac.at/~hahsler/research/ virlib_working2001/virlib/.
    • (2001)
    • Geyer-Schulz, A.1    Hahsler, M.2
  • 25
    • 0003026194 scopus 로고    scopus 로고
    • "From Non-Functional Requirements to Design through Patterns"
    • D. Gross and E.S.K. Yu, "From Non-Functional Requirements to Design through Patterns," Requirements Eng., vol. 6, no. 1, pp. 18-36, 2001.
    • (2001) Requirements Eng. , vol.6 , Issue.1 , pp. 18-36
    • Gross, D.1    Yu, E.S.K.2
  • 26
    • 0032203845 scopus 로고    scopus 로고
    • "Using Abstraction and Model Checking to Detect Safety Violations in Requirements Specifications"
    • Nov.
    • C. Heitmeyer, J. Kirby Jr., B. Labaw, M. Archer, and R. Bharadwaj, "Using Abstraction and Model Checking to Detect Safety Violations in Requirements Specifications," IEEE Trans. Software Eng., vol. 24, no. 11, pp. 927-948, Nov. 1998.
    • (1998) IEEE Trans. Software Eng. , vol.24 , Issue.11 , pp. 927-948
    • Heitmeyer, C.1    Kirby Jr., J.2    Labaw, B.3    Archer, M.4    Bharadwaj, R.5
  • 27
    • 18944390941 scopus 로고    scopus 로고
    • "The Model Checker SPIN"
    • May
    • G.J. Holzmann, "The Model Checker SPIN," IEEE Trans. Software Eng., vol. 23, no. 5, May 1997.
    • (1997) IEEE Trans. Software Eng. , vol.23 , Issue.5
    • Holzmann, G.J.1
  • 29
    • 84948965381 scopus 로고    scopus 로고
    • "Object/Relational Access Layers - A Roadmap, Missing Links and More Pattems"
    • July
    • W. Keller, "Object/Relational Access Layers - A Roadmap, Missing Links and More Pattems," Proc. EuroPLoP 1998 Conf., July 1998.
    • (1998) Proc. EuroPLoP 1998 Conf.
    • Keller, W.1
  • 30
    • 33645265146 scopus 로고    scopus 로고
    • "Defining and Using Requirements Patterns for Embedded Systems"
    • master's thesis, Michigan State Univ., East Lansing, Aug.
    • S. Konrad, "Defining and Using Requirements Patterns for Embedded Systems," master's thesis, Michigan State Univ., East Lansing, Aug. 2003.
    • (2003)
    • Konrad, S.1
  • 35
    • 33645267854 scopus 로고    scopus 로고
    • "Object Analysis Patterns for Embedded Systems"
    • Technical Report MSU-CSE-04-29, Computer Science and Eng., Michigan State Univ., East Lansing, Oct.
    • S. Konrad, B.H.C. Cheng, and L.A. Campbell, "Object Analysis Patterns for Embedded Systems," Technical Report MSU-CSE-04-29, Computer Science and Eng., Michigan State Univ., East Lansing, Oct. 2004.
    • (2004)
    • Konrad, S.1    Cheng, B.H.C.2    Campbell, L.A.3
  • 37
    • 4243853972 scopus 로고
    • "Design Patterns for Avionics Control Systems"
    • Technical Report ADAGE-OSW-94-01, DSSA Adage Project
    • D. Lea, "Design Patterns for Avionics Control Systems," Technical Report ADAGE-OSW-94-01, DSSA Adage Project, 1994.
    • (1994)
    • Lea, D.1
  • 44
    • 33645261323 scopus 로고    scopus 로고
    • "Requirements Patterns via Events/Use Cases"
    • S. Robertson, "Requirements Patterns via Events/Use Cases," 1996, http://www.systemsguild.com/GuildSite/SQR/ Requirements_Patterns.html.
    • (1996)
    • Robertson, S.1
  • 45
    • 85016111200 scopus 로고
    • "The Role of Natural Language in Requirements Engineering"
    • K. Ryan, "The Role of Natural Language in Requirements Engineering," Proc. IEEE Int'l Symp. Requirements Eng., pp. 240-242, 1993.
    • (1993) Proc. IEEE Int'l. Symp. Requirements Eng. , pp. 240-242
    • Ryan, K.1
  • 46
    • 3943076011 scopus 로고    scopus 로고
    • "Some Patterns for Software Architectures"
    • M. Shaw, "Some Patterns for Software Architectures," Pattern Languages of Program Design vol. 2, pp. 255-269, 1996.
    • (1996) Pattern Languages of Program Design , vol.2 , pp. 255-269
    • Shaw, M.1
  • 48
    • 33645267704 scopus 로고    scopus 로고
    • "DASCo Project - Development of Distributed Applications with Separation of Concerns"
    • A.R. Silva, "DASCo Project - Development of Distributed Applications with Separation of Concerns," 2000, http://www.esw.inesc.pt/~ars/ dasco/.
    • (2000)
    • Silva, A.R.1
  • 49
    • 0032290141 scopus 로고    scopus 로고
    • "Supporting Scenario-Based Requirements Engineering"
    • Dec.
    • A.G. Sutcliffe, N.A. Maiden, S. Minocha, and D. Manuel, "Supporting Scenario-Based Requirements Engineering," Software Eng., vol. 24, no. 12, pp. 1072-1088, Dec. 1998.
    • (1998) Software Eng. , vol.24 , Issue.12 , pp. 1072-1088
    • Sutcliffe, A.G.1    Maiden, N.A.2    Minocha, S.3    Manuel, D.4
  • 50
    • 15844372232 scopus 로고    scopus 로고
    • "Project Specifications for Diesel Filter System and Electronically Controlled Steering System"
    • A. Torre, "Project Specifications for Diesel Filter System and Electronically Controlled Steering System," 2000, http://www.cse. msu.edu/~cse470/F2000/cheng/Projects/F00-Cheng/.
    • (2000)
    • Torre, A.1
  • 51
    • 33645257160 scopus 로고    scopus 로고
    • Diagnostic patterns
    • private comm., May
    • A. Torre, Diagnostic patterns, private comm., May 2003.
    • (2003)
    • Torre, A.1
  • 52
    • 33645264887 scopus 로고    scopus 로고
    • "Project Specifications for Anti-Lock Brake System and Adaptive Cruise Control System"
    • A. Torre and J. Bowers, "Project Specifications for Anti-Lock Brake System and Adaptive Cruise Control System," 2001, http://www.cse. msu.edu/~cse470/F01/Projects/.
    • (2001)
    • Torre, A.1    Bowers, J.2


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.